Yes I agree, yorkies come in all shapes and sizes. If he is larger than what the standard states (no more than 7 pounds) it doesn't mean he isn't a full yorkie. Also many uninformed people think that all yorkies have upright ears, and that if they have floppy ears they are mixed. Not true! The ears must be trained to stay up by trimming the hair on the top third of the ear, and sometimes requiring taping them up. But many people also like the floppy eared look bc they have that "forever puppy" look.

There are many on here with bigger yorkies. We affectionately call them "teapots" a play on the word "teacup", which btw there is no such classification of teacup size yorkies.
